
On Friday, January 9th, the day of storm Elli, the school day was very different than usual. While 469 pupils normally attend our school, there were only 24 children on site that day. The empty corridors and classrooms created an unusual, almost silent atmosphere.
The few children present spent the day in a calm and cozy atmosphere. There was a lot of painting, and in between the children also learned some German and math, without any time pressure and in a relaxed atmosphere.
Teachers and children made themselves comfortable together. In the third and fourth lessons, some of the children watched the movie “Taming Dragons Made Easy”, while others preferred to continue drawing and put snowmen on paper, for example.
